The Book Woman of Troublesome Creek by Kim Michele Richardson is historical fiction about a little known group of people that once lived in the hills of southern USA. This heartbreaking, powerful story of a woman struggling to bring hope through books to the far-flung families of the Kentucky hills during the mid 1930's. FDR's New Deal included a program called the Pack Horse Library Project. Cussy Carter is one of the women employed by the Project. While her father fights the injustice of the coal mine company, battling black-lung and cave ins, Cussy risks her safety on her route. Trigger warnings: The poverty and prejudice is intense. There are several disturbing assault scenes, rape, and forced medical experimentation, and some grisly descriptions of injuries. Yes, it's a tough read at times. It is a part of American history I feel has been nearly lost, and a very important story to remember. Cussy's strength makes it all worth it.
